I'm back from visiting the midwife

Well that sucked. She said everything looks and feels good but she?s not happy I?ve waited almost an entire year to tell her that we?re having trouble getting pregnant. She said the wait a year thing for people my age is old news.  So she is sending Ben to get a semen analysis.  I haven?t told him this yet, because he forgot his phone today?why today?!!  and I am getting some procedure done where they check everything to make sure I don?t have any blockage in my tubes.

 

So I need to  call and set that appointment up. I?m praying that I?m pregnant/got pregnant this month. I never thought I would get to the point of needing to see a reproductive specialist.

  • I loved our RE's office.  We went to Reproductive Associates of DE. 

    Mark wasn't thrilled with having to do the SA either.  I think he was worried that it might be his fault.  I had a HSG done and it showed a blocked tube, however a laparoscopic surgery by my RE showed my tubes were fine.  (Apparently, my muscle spasmed  so the dye couldn't flow through. )
